Fueling Connections, One Cup at a Time
Are you a coffee connoisseur with a heart for service? Join our team of Hospitality volunteers and take charge of our delightful coffee! Our Hospitality volunteers play a crucial role in providing a comfortable, clean, and welcoming environment for our clients. Step into the spotlight as you ensure every visitor feels at ease and valued from the moment they enter our space.
Welcoming, Safe, and Supportive – Be the Change!
Do you want to make a real difference in people’s lives? Our Intake Advocates play a crucial role in creating a welcoming, safe, and supportive space for our clients. By helping them fill out intake paperwork and assisting with administrative tasks, you can directly contribute to transforming lives.
Guiding Clients Towards a Brighter Future
Are you ready to guide individuals through the complex web of homeless services and funding processes? Join our team of Navigators! With your experience and additional training, you will empower our clients by connecting them with the right resources and services to achieve stability after being rehoused.
Behind-the-Scenes Heroes Making a Difference
If you prefer working behind the scenes but still want to make an impact, our Volunteer Support position is perfect for you. You’ll manage clerical needs, handle phone calls, scan documents, and assist with filing. Your extensive knowledge of our procedures will make you an invaluable asset, working closely with the Operations Director.
Harnessing the Power of Technology
Do you have a passion for technology? As an IT Volunteer, you’ll utilize cutting-edge tools and processes to create, process, store, secure, and exchange electronic data for Sidewalk. Join us in leveraging technology to drive positive change and empower our mission.

There’s nothing in the world quite like a group of people coming together to solve a problem. Every week, SideWalk volunteers contribute their time and talents to work with adults experiencing homelessness. With over 60 volunteers working together, we’ve helped over 1,800 people escape the streets since 2012.
